Protecting your septic system is crucial for maintaining a healthy house environment and ensuring that your wastewater management operates effectively. A septic system is designed to treat wastewater in a safe and sustainable method. However, without proper care, it can easily become overwhelmed, resulting in pricey repairs and environmental hazards.
Common inspection and maintenance are key to ensuring the longevity of your septic system. Routine checks assist identify potential problems before they escalate. It is advisable to schedule professional inspections a minimum of each three years. Knowledgeable service providers can offer insights into the situation of your system and recommend any necessary actions.

Planting the proper vegetation can additionally be a important side of protecting your septic system. Bushes and large shrubs should be evaded the leach subject. Their roots can invade the septic system, resulting in blockages and harm. Choose shallow-rooted crops for landscaping near your system to maintain up its integrity while enjoying an aesthetically pleasing yard.
While it might be tempting to disregard signs of a failing septic system, it's critical to concentrate to warning indicators. Foul odors, sluggish drains, and wet spots in your yard can be signs of a malfunctioning system.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ent from aggravated harm and restore the system's effectivity.

Sustaining the realm around your septic system can additionally be important for its protection. Avoid driving or parking autos on the leach field, as this will compact the soil. Moreover, hold heavy equipment away to stop pointless stress on the system.
Septic tank pumping is another essential facet of maintenance. Over time, solids accumulate on the backside of the tank. It is essential to have your septic tank pumped every three to 5 years to forestall overflow and ensure optimal efficiency. - Frequently inspect and pump your septic tank each three to 5 years to stop overflow and system failure.
- Use water-efficient fixtures to scale back the quantity of water coming into the septic system, ensuring optimal efficiency.
- Keep Away From flushing non-biodegradable objects like wipes and feminine products to forestall clogging and harm to the system.
- Plant grass or shallow-rooted plants over the drain area to reinforce absorption with out risking root intrusion into the septic lines.
- Divert rainwater and surface runoff away from the septic system to scale back extra water and maintain proper drainage.
- Limit using harsh chemical substances and detergents, as these can disrupt the pure bacterial activity crucial for waste breakdown.
- Establish a clear entry path to the septic tank for maintenance and emergency conditions, stopping accidental damage to the area.
- Maintain automobiles and heavy gear away from the drain subject to keep away from soil compaction, which might hinder the system's function.
- Monitor the system's drainage and look for signs of trouble, such as slow drains or foul odors, addressing issues promptly.

How often ought to I get my septic system pumped?undefinedSeptic systems usually need to be pumped each three to 5 years, relying on usage and dimension. Regular pumping helps prevent solids from accumulating and inflicting blockages that may lead to system failure.
Can I flush something down the toilet?undefinedNo, you must keep away from flushing items like wipes, feminine merchandise, and chemicals as they'll clog your system and disrupt the natural bacterial stability essential for breaking down waste.
What can I do to maintain up my septic system?undefinedCommon pumping, conserving water, using septic-safe merchandise, and avoiding overloading the system with heavy use are all important maintenance practices. Routine inspections can help catch any points early.
Are there vegetation I can grow close to my septic system?undefinedWhereas some plants could be planted close to your septic system, it’s best to keep away from bushes and large shrubs with deep roots, as they will invade the system and trigger damage. Choose for grass or shallow-rooted vegetation.

What ought to I do if my septic system backs up?undefinedIf you expertise a backup, stop using water immediately and name a licensed septic professional. Continued use can exacerbate the issue and potentially cause harm to your system.
Am I Able To use a garbage disposal with a septic system?undefinedUsing a rubbish disposal can enhance the amount of solid waste in your septic tank. If you do use one, make certain to pump your system more frequently and restrict the quantity of food waste you dispose of.

Are there septic components I ought to use?undefinedMost experts agree that septic additives are unnecessary should you preserve your system properly. Natural bacteria and enzymes already exist within the septic tank and are usually enough for waste breakdown.
